Much help still needed in Myanmar
Fida continues
reconstruction in the country
08 Aug 2008
Fida
International continues giving aid to and reconstruction in
Myanmar (Burma) after last May cyclone. In addition to
donations from its European and American partners and
individuals, Fida was granted 100,000 euros for the
operation by the Ministry for Foreign Affairs of Finland in
July. The aid work is being carried out in 21 villages of
the worst hit delta area and in cooperation with local
partner, the Myanmar Assemblies of God.
In the end of July
four more aid cargos were on the way to Yangon. The
agency’s humanitarian aid specialist has worked onsite in
June. In addition, a Thai partner sent their experienced
post-disaster trauma and gender counselling teams to assist.
Rehabilitation
will include repairing houses, providing restarter packets
for families and necessary items for school children and
recreation of livelihoods.

“This work will be
done by the local church working with entire communities,
where the already established village development committees
oversee the work so that all the people are helped,” tells
Mr Jukka Harjula,
Fida’s Regional Development Cooperation Coordinator for
South East Asia.
Mr Harjula
rejoices of the cooperation spirit among the Myanmarese
Christians. He also mentions that many local organisations
have been interested in the Community Health Education
method which Fida and its partner have been implementing in
the country since many years.
Still many
villages in the delta are without help. An estimated 130,000
people are dead or missing, over two million people affected
and agriculture of the country devastated. A recent joint
assessment by ASEAN, the UN and the Myanmarese government
estimates that it takes immense efforts worth' $1billion'
(646 million euros) for the next three years to meet even
the basic needs in food provision, agriculture and housing.

Fida and the AOG
of Myanmar have been in co-operation since 1997 in
development co-operation. Myanmar is one of the first
countries where Fida has worked. Fida is a partnership
organisation in development of the Ministry for Foreign
Affairs of Finland and has also agreement with ECHO, the
European Union Directorate General for Humanitarian Aid. The
organisation carries out development co-operation,
humanitarian aid and support a child programmes and projects
in about 30 countries and works all together in about 50
countries of the world. |
